- The distance between Dover, Tn, Usa and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ari, India is approximately 12,949 km or 8,047 mi.
- To reach Dover, Tn in this distance one would set out from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ari bearing 2.7°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Dover, Tn bearing 177° or S .
- Dover, Tn has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
- Dover, Tn is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ari is in or near the subtropical wet for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 9.3 °C (16.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.9 °C (21.4°F) more in Dover, Tn.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1223.7 mm (48.2 in) less which is equivalent to 1223.7 l/m² (30.03 US gal/ft²) or 12,237,000 l/ha (1,308,217 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.5° lower in Dover, Tn than in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ari.
